Output 44a84afbdd83bc05a96271ca11d5837bb5adb762d79d66d7536b05ac3255376d:0

value
2512057
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c1a6a75598610eaaf1a86518a3d07b69e71bb99 OP_EQUALVERIFY OP_CHECKSIG
address
1DmoFGC4myWgRMQL5byEJSsJ8gDEZLDoat
transaction
44a84afbdd83bc05a96271ca11d5837bb5adb762d79d66d7536b05ac3255376d
confirmations
590431
spent
true